Frequently Asked Questions
What specific local issues in Kosse, TX, should I discuss with a real estate attorney before buying rural land?
In Kosse and surrounding Limestone County, it's crucial to discuss easements for oil/gas access, water rights from wells or ponds, and agricultural exemptions with a local attorney. They can also verify there are no hidden liens or title issues common with inherited rural properties in the area.
How can a Kosse real estate attorney help with a 'For Sale by Owner' (FSBO) transaction?
A local attorney can draft or review the contract to ensure it complies with Texas property law, handle the title search and title insurance through a local abstract company, and coordinate the closing process. This is vital in Kosse, where many transactions involve unique rural property features not covered by standard forms.
Are there unique zoning or permitting issues in Kosse that a real estate attorney should review?
Yes. While Kosse itself has limited zoning, Limestone County has regulations for septic systems, building setbacks, and land use. An attorney familiar with the county can advise on permits for new construction, mobile home placement, or running a business from your property to avoid future violations.
What should I expect to pay for a real estate attorney's services for a residential closing in Kosse?
Fees are typically a flat rate ranging from $800 to $1,500 for a standard residential closing, depending on the transaction's complexity. This is often lower than in major metro areas, but costs can increase if the property involves mineral rights disputes, probate issues, or significant boundary surveys.
When is it absolutely necessary to hire a real estate attorney for a property transaction in Kosse?
It's strongly advised for any non-standard transaction, such as buying land with an inherited heirship issue, drafting a contract for a property with mineral rights reservations, or resolving a boundary dispute with a neighbor over fence lines or access roads common in rural Limestone County.
